Skip to content

Client binaries from DigitalOcean -> AWS#5077

Merged
bfops merged 4 commits into
masterfrom
bfops/aws
May 20, 2026
Merged

Client binaries from DigitalOcean -> AWS#5077
bfops merged 4 commits into
masterfrom
bfops/aws

Conversation

@bfops
Copy link
Copy Markdown
Collaborator

@bfops bfops commented May 19, 2026

Description of Changes

Use an AWS bucket for client binaries instead of DigitalOcean.

Note that this will effectively hamstring the DigitalOcean mirror for any old clients (i.e. ones before this change is released). But it's only a mirror, and they can "fix" it by upgrading to a version with this change.

API and ABI breaking changes

None

Expected complexity level and risk

1

Testing

  • Manually ran the package job on this PR and confirmed that some of the resulting URLs are indeed downloadable from the AWS urls

Comment thread .github/workflows/attach-artifacts.yml
@bfops bfops marked this pull request as ready for review May 20, 2026 01:56
Comment thread .github/workflows/benchmarks.yml
Copy link
Copy Markdown
Contributor

@cloutiertyler cloutiertyler left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

This will only break for old clients if GitHub is down, right?

@bfops bfops enabled auto-merge May 20, 2026 02:28
@bfops bfops added this pull request to the merge queue May 20, 2026
Merged via the queue into master with commit 8641c17 May 20, 2026
98 of 101 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ants